quote:

Holden, what do you think will happen when they try and conduct this end run around of the constitution?


Well . . .

Trump could seek to enjoin it on the front end. I doubt that would work. Courts would abstain on political question.

If he is acquitted, that is the end of it.

If he is convicted and barred, he will have to sue for a declaration that the proceeding was invalidly conducted.

Here is where it gets interesting. If it makes it to the Supreme Court, which it undoubtedly will, Roberts gets to sit in judgment on whether a proceeding in which Roberts refused to participate is invalid because Roberts did not preside.

Now that is going to be a con law headscratcher right there.
